Figure (8-E12) shows two blocks A and B, each having
a mass of 320 g connected by a light string passing over
a smooth light pulley. The horizontal surface on which
the block A can slide is smooth. The block A is attached
to a spring of spring constant 40 N/m whose other end
is fixed to a support 40 cm above the horizontal surface.
Initially, the spring is vertical and unstretched when the
system is released to move. Find the velocity of the block
A at the instant it breaks off the surface below it. Take
g  10 m/s 2.
